Ⅰ ORACLE和PLsql Developer什麼關系
ORACLE是資料庫也有客戶端和伺服器。
PLSQL Developer是連接oracle的可視化客戶端軟體。
PLSQL Developer只是第三方工具,服務於ORACLE,類似的工具還有Toad,sqlplus,sql developer等等。
oracle的安裝一般是指oracle服務端的安裝,PLSQL Developer客戶端的安裝和oracle的安裝沒有必要條件的關系,只是oracle服務端安裝成功,客戶端才能連接服務端進行使用。
(1)plsqldeveloper擴展閱讀:
Oracle系統有以下結構:
ORACLE資料庫系統為具有管理ORACLE資料庫功能的計算機系統。每一個運行的ORACLE資料庫與一個ORACLE實例(INSTANCE)相聯系。一個ORACLE實例為存取和控制一資料庫的軟體機制。
每一次在資料庫伺服器上啟動一資料庫時,稱為系統全局區(SYSTEM GLOBAL AREA)的一內存區(簡稱SGA)被分配,有一個或多個ORACLE進程被啟動。該SGA 和 ORACLE進程的結合稱為一個ORACLE資料庫實例。
一個實例的SGA和進程為管理資料庫數據、為該資料庫一個或多個用戶服務而工作。
在ORACLE系統中,首先是實例啟動,然後由實例裝配(MOUNT)一資料庫。在松耦合系統中,在具有ORACLE PARALLEL SERVER 選項時,單個資料庫可被多個實例裝配,即多個實例共享同一物理資料庫。
參考資料來源:網路-Oracle系統
網路-PL/SQL Developer
Ⅱ plsql developer怎麼使用
1、首先plsql developer連接小編這里就不做介紹了大家不知道可以看看這篇文章:
2、登陸成功後即可進入對象瀏覽器窗口界面
3、在對象瀏覽器選擇「my object」,這里邊就是SCOTT(當前登陸的用戶的所有object)
4、找到table文件夾,里邊就是當前賬戶的所有表格
5、選中需要查看的表——》右鍵——》選中「查詢數據」【query data】,即可看到數據了
6、新建——》選中sql window,即可打開sql窗口了
7、在sql窗口內輸入sql語句,全選,點擊執行即可查看到結果,功能很強大
8、選中表——》右鍵——》Edit(編輯),可以對表進行編輯。
Ⅲ pl/sql developer和sql developer有什麼區別
您好,大多數人都推薦PL/SQL DEVELOPER,但是也有的說Oracle SQLDEVELOPER用著順手
他們功能上有什麼區別嗎?每個人對工具的了解程度不同,對工具的喜好也會有差異。 我兩種工具都用過,大致上功能都是一樣的,我就談談差異吧 plsql還是比較主流的,在開發和管理上都比較方便,還支持導入。導出功能, 不過需要安裝Oracle的客戶端,並且需要配置tnsname。這是我覺得,他稍微弱勢的一點。 Oracle psql dev呢,是Oracle自帶的工具,11g已經內嵌到資料庫的安裝里去了,也提供比較好的開發和管理的功能,但是相對plsql來說,要弱一些,不過其中帶有的migration tools是我鍾情於此工具的一點。 可以對異構或者同構的資料庫進行數據遷移,我在mysql和ms sql上都做個不是很復雜的遷移,還是很方便和實用的,而且該工具最好的一點是 java開發,使用的jdbc的連接方式,所以即使沒有安裝客戶端也可以通過thin的方式連接 這兩個工具在開發和管理上 plsql dev 勝出一籌 但是在遷移功能和跨平台上 sql dev又亮點多多。 你根據你自己的情況來進行選擇吧。
Ⅳ 怎麼打開plsql developer
1、介紹如下:
2、登陸成功後即可進入對象瀏覽器窗口界面
3、在對象瀏覽器選擇「my object」,這里邊就是SCOTT(當前登陸的用戶的所有object)
4、找到table文件夾,里邊就是當前賬戶的所有表格
5、選中需要查看的表——》右鍵——》選中「查詢數據」【query data】,即可看到數據了
6、新建——》選中sql window,即可打開sql窗口了
7、在sql窗口內輸入sql語句,全選,點擊執行即可查看到結果,功能很強大
8、選中表——》右鍵——》Edit(編輯),可以對表進行編輯。
Ⅳ 如何配置plsql developer
需要在tns上配置訪問的資料庫信息,plsql
developer安裝後,會自動識別,不需要其它配置
Ⅵ pl sql developer怎麼執行sql
1、打開plsql,並登陸到指定的資料庫。
2、打開sql窗口。
3、寫好sql語句後,全選,然後點執行按鈕,如圖:
Ⅶ toad和plsql developer個有什麼優缺點
toad是第三方軟體 你只要記住功能比sqlplus功能更強大就可以了 建議使用toad 但是在sqlplus下也要經常使用,因為如果換了工作環境,而無法使用toad或plsql developer這樣的工具的話。還可以用sqlplus來完成工作 對,toad就是通過client與oracle...
Ⅷ oracle sql developer 和pl sql developer有什麼不同
A1.sqldeveloper 是oracle自己推出的開發工具,在JDK 6u18之前,linux系統下很不穩定,經常出現無響應的情況。之後的穩定性有了很大的改進。
A2.支持多平台(fedora、ubuntu等桌面級linux上唯一可用的圖形化開發工具);
A3.免費;
A4.除了可以連接oracle資料庫以外,sybase、mysql、mssqlserver、MS Access等資料庫也可以訪問查看數據;
A5.同一個界面可以登陸多個資料庫,方便在多個資料庫之間操作;
A6.支持自定義快捷鍵可以實現組合鍵清空界面、組合鍵復制代碼等快捷操作;
A7.比較佔用內存消耗資源較多,這是缺點也是優點,缺點是相對消耗資源,(但是對於筆記本、台式機CPU性能過剩、內存白菜價的今天,基本可以忽略不計),優點是由於佔用較多內存在執行幾十、幾百條sql的效率上很高,不像PL/SQL Dev還要有一個初始化的動作。例如執行上百條insert into xxx values(123,'aa');之類的語句,可以將這兩款軟體進行比對;
A8.個人感覺導出功能強於PL/SQL Dev 有不同意見的歡迎討論,例如導出一個用戶下的所有表結構、存儲過程、視圖、數據鏈接等等;
A9.對11g的一些新特性支持到位;
B1.PL/SQL Dev是老牌的開發工具,穩定性很高;
B2.不支持unix、linux等平台;
B3.不免費,但實際上這一點基本上可以忽略;
B4.新版本也開始支持其他資料庫的連接,但支持的種類還是不夠全;
B5.要同時訪問多個資料庫的話需要啟動多個軟體界面;
B6.不支持自定義快捷鍵,但是界面上的按鍵也足夠開發者使用了;
B7.資源佔用很少;
B8.HTML Manual功能可以將從oracle下載的官方文檔直接索引到自己的幫助當中,尤其適合不能上網的環境,即便能上網,在這個裡面搜索一些語法、錯誤號等效率也是很高的;
B9.report窗口支持直接從用sql當中選取表的欄位來做成圖表,例如餅、曲線、柱狀、雷達圖等,可以另存為PDF、圖片等。
B10.支持select * from xxx for update的修改方式,sqldeveloper貌似不支持(至少我還不會)
我能想到的大概也就是這些,因為我經常在Fedora系統下辦公,所以對sqldeveloper玩的比較多,基本上這兩款軟體我都會用,終上所述,個人認為兩款軟體可以同時存在於你的系統當中,同時使用可以事半功倍、相得益彰。
Ⅸ 如何配置oracle client 和 plsql developer
1. 下載Oracle的客戶端程序包(30M)
只需要在 Oracle 下載一個叫 Instant Client Package 的軟體就可以了,這個軟體不需要安裝,只要解壓就可以用了,很方便,就算重裝了系統還是可以用的。
解壓到一個目錄中即可,例如c:\oracleclient
2. 配置操作系統環境變數
NLS_LANG=SIMPLIFIED CHINESE_CHINA.ZHS16GBK
TNS_ADMIN=C:\oracleclient
3. 配置連接Oracle的配置。tnsnames.ora文件到目錄C:\oracleclient。可以從oracle伺服器拷貝一個過來。
內容類似:
# tnsnames.ora Network Configuration File: E:\oracle\proct\10.2.0\db_1\network\admin\tnsnames.ora
# Generated by Oracle configuration tools.
ORCLProct =
(DESCRIPTION =
(ADDRESS = (PROTOCOL = TCP)(HOST = prmpatm1.asiapacific.hpqcorp.NET)(PORT = 1521))
(CONNECT_DATA =
(SERVER = DEDICATED)
(SERVICE_NAME = orcl)
)
)
ORCL122 =
(DESCRIPTION =
(ADDRESS = (PROTOCOL = TCP)(HOST = 16.157.133.122)(PORT = 1521))
(CONNECT_DATA =
(SERVER = DEDICATED)
(SERVICE_NAME = orcl)
)
)
EXTPROC_CONNECTION_DATA =
(DESCRIPTION =
(ADDRESS_LIST =
(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C1))
)
(CONNECT_DATA =
(SID = PLSExtProc)
(PRESENTATION = RO)
)
)
4. 安裝PLSQL Developer
5. 配置PLSQL Developer(第一次可以不用登錄直接進到PLSQL Developer)
Tools --> Preferences--> Connections,
Oracle Home內容為 C:\oracleclient
OCI library內容為 C:\oracleclient\oci.dll
重新啟動PLSQLDeveloper
完畢